1. The Power of Emotional Openness

Imagine a world where openly expressing your feelings and thoughts wasn’t considered a risk but a strength. Emotional openness, the ability to be candid about one’s feelings, is a cornerstone of authentic relationships. Contrary to popular belief, men respect women who embrace this vulnerability, seeing it as a sign of trust and honesty.

This openness fosters a deep connection beyond superficial interactions, creating a safe space for empathy and understanding. It’s not about being an open book to everyone but about choosing to be open with someone who values that sincerity.

3. Emotional Intelligence: Navigating Feelings Together

Emotional intelligence is your ability to understand your emotions and those around you. It’s about navigating the complex landscape of feelings with grace and understanding. Women who exhibit high emotional intelligence in their relationships often find that men respect and are attracted to it.

This intelligence lays the groundwork for maturely handling relationship dynamics, paving the path for a deeper understanding and connection between partners.

6. Communicating Needs and Desires Clearly

Clear communication is the linchpin of healthy relationships and is essential for expressing needs, desires, and boundaries. It’s about being open and honest about what you need from your partner, creating a culture of respect and mutual understanding.

Effective communication deepens emotional connections and ensures that both partners are aligned in their expectations and feelings, preventing misunderstandings before they can start.
